The course aims to provide a deep dive into the critical legislative package associated with the Digital Operational Resilience Act (DORA), which has recently come into force, and is designed to addresses a key risk factor in the EU digital space: cyberattacks and ICT disruptions in the EU financial sector. These risks have been a concern for Europe's bank and securities regulators for many years, notably the ECB, the EBA and ESMA. This long overdue piece of legislation now consolidates a patchwork of existing sectoral rules on ICT risk management, incident handling and resilience testing. Critically, and core to the thrust of DORA, is the explicit recognition on the reliance by financial services entities on third party ICT service providers. Oversight of 3rd party ICT service providers will fall to the ESA's (EBA, ESMA and EIOPA). ESMA is also currently drafting technical standards, following DORA's entry into force on 16 January 2023, with application scheduled for 17th January 2025. An overview of the complex nature of the EU legislative process and the key EU Institutions involved in the development of the DORA regulatory text will be examined during the course, covering:The shift from operational risk mainly with the allocation of capital to managing all components of operational resilience.The DORA rules for the protection, detection, containment, recovery and repair capabilities against ICT-related incidents.Identifying the DORA explicitly referenced ICT risks via new sets rules on ICT risk-management, incident reporting, operational resilience testing and ICT third-party risk monitoring.
